Let’s start this journey, Firstly, you have to look for some outdoor brick fireplace plans. There’re plenty of free ones. Choose the one that you like and see, what and how much material you have to buy. But cement blocks and a cement solution are the most necessary things. When you got everything you need, begin your brick outdoor fireplace DIY with laying out the blocks to form a pedestal. Fill the blocks in with the pieces of a foam board, so that you don’t have to waste cement on that. Also, install some vertical foam stripes in the outer part of the base, so that the mortar won’t spill out. Then fill the top parts of the blocks and space between them with the cement solution. Remove the unnecessary foam and lay concrete flats on the top of the base. It’s where the actual fireplace is going to sit on. Fill all the gaps with mortal and start laying the bricks according to your project.
